Drawbacks: What Could Make The 338 Lapua A Poor Choice For Hunting

a hunter, you may be considering the 338 Lapua for your next hunting rifle. While it is true that the 338 Lapua is an incredibly powerful round, and is often used for long-range target shooting, there are some drawbacks that make it a poor choice for hunting.

Firstly, the 338 Lapua is a very large and heavy round, and rifles chambered for it are often quite bulky. This means that carrying the rifle on a hunting trip can be cumbersome and uncomfortable.

Secondly, the 338 Lapua is a very expensive caliber, both in terms of the ammo cost and the rifle itself. This makes it difficult to justify using it for hunting, unless you are a dedicated long-range shooter. Finally, the 338 Lapua is a very loud round and produces a significant amount of recoil, which can be off-putting to some hunters. For these reasons, the 338 Lapua is probably not the best choice for hunting.

3. What are the drawbacks of using the 338 Lapua for hunting?

The main drawback of using the 338 Lapua for hunting is its price. It is a relatively expensive round, and not everyone can afford the cost of the ammunition. Additionally, the recoil of the round can be significant, and may not be suitable for everyone.

4. Is the 338 Lapua a good choice for beginner hunters?

The 338 Lapua is not a good choice for beginner hunters due to its cost and recoil. It is a powerful, accurate round, but can be difficult for a novice hunter to control. Beginner hunters should opt for a less powerful, more affordable round, such as the 308 Winchester.
